Set Goals & an Action Plan

You are probably totally sick of this suggestion!  Many times we set goals only to let them go by the wayside because it all just seems to hard … and we lose motivation. It can be a frustrating cycle.

My tip here is to really ask yourself why you want xyz. Why you want to lose weight, be healthier, be stronger. Keep asking yourself why until you find the strong unlying reason … this reason is usually incredibly personal to you. You will know when you finally acknowledge your why.

Do you want to feel better about yourself, have more energy, more confidence, or do you have some health concerns you would like to address so they don’t get worse? Once you work out exactly why motivation to keep going gets a little bit easier! Create your action plan of how you will achieve your goal. These are actions that you do on the regular that will get you heading in the direction of your goal. I won’t go into creating your whole action plan here as it gets a little complex, but working out exactly what you have to do each and every day is what you need to do. Reminders

Remind yourself of your goals & actions every single day, as often as needed. You may want to spend a few minutes each day writing them down. Do it. It’s a great way to set yourself up for the day and get your motivation flowing! Write down what your goal is, why you want it and how you will feel once you achieve it.

Another way some of my clients remind themselves are little notes to themselves. It might be a note on the bathroom mirror or a wallpaper picture on your phone. It might just be a word that triggers that reminder, or the password on your computer that everyday reminds you of your goals.

Maybe it’s a behaviour reminder. Little notes to yourself on the fridge ( or in the fridge ) “I make healthy & nutritious choices. I can do this!”. Put your workout clothes beside the bed with your shoes so that they are your reminder first thing in the morning to head out. You don’t need motivation, you just need the reminder to get moving because your goal is important to you!

Support

We could all do with a little support, especially when it’s a little harder to motivate ourselves. Having someone beside you supporting, encouraging and helping you can make a big difference.

You might have a regular appointment with your PT, your dietician or even your workout partner or group that keeps you going and keeps you accountable. Not only is it someone to be accountable to but that little boost of motivation & inspiration in regular doses can certainly help stoking your fire.
